Graham Flat Enclosure

Photograph of the Graham Flat Enclosure on the west end of Graham Flat in the east part of the Big Game Pasture. Flats site (loamy bottom in excellent condition, light utilization). Flattened appearance of vegetation near enclosure is largely due to characteristic lodging of big bluestem, plus some trampling and bedding damage by buffalo.

Little Bluestem Advancing

Photograph of little bluestem advancing into flat from adjacent higher ground. This area was a prairie dog townh before th3ey were killed out. Dominant vegetation is silver bluestem, curlycup gumweed, blue grama, and buffalograss. West end of Big Game Pasture, in Fullingim Flat east of enclosure.
